The Music, Computing, and Design (MCD) research group aims to conduct cutting-edge, artful research in computer music.
Our research includes work in artful design of software systems for computer music (of all types and sizes); programming languages and interactive environments (e.g. ChucK, miniAudicle); social, cognitive, human aspects of music and computing; mobile music / social music (e.g., mobile phone orchestra: MoPhO, MoMu, Ocarina, Smule); software interfaces / interaction paradigms for composition, performance, and education; computer-mediated performance ensembles + paradigms (e.g., laptop orchestras: SLOrk); music information retrieval; and education at the intersection of computer science and music.
